Free electronics recycling in Seymour on Saturday

The Indiana Department of Environmental Management, Technology Recyclers, Cummins Inc. and the Jackson County Solid Waste Management District are hosting a free electronics recycling event from 9 a.m. until noon on Saturday, Nov. 5, at 847 East 4th St., Seymour.

This electronics recycling collection event is open to the public and helps to keep hazardous waste found in electronics from ending up in landfills. Unwanted electronics can be dropped off by drive-up or walk-up at no cost.

For a contactless delivery, please stay in your vehicle and staff from Technology Recyclers will unload your unwanted electronics. Accepted e-waste items include TVs, cables and wiring, cellphones, computer towers and monitors, printers, batteries, camcorders and cameras, copiers, DVD players, DVR devices, microwaves, games systems, e-readers, printers, routers, scanners and more.
